Elvis - Randomly decided to watch this, I don't have any strong feelings for him as an artist, and most of what I know about him is just general pop culture stuff, so I can't say what the film does right or wrong as a biopic, though it seemed well received.  It does feel strange having the movie kinda handle the narrative from the point of view of Parker, a problematic figure in Elvis life, but it could be said that any embellishment the stories might've made, could be seen as spin by Parker perhaps.  Not that they surgar coat who he was, they very clearly put the light on him as opportunist determined to milk Elvis for all he could.

That stuff aside, it was a good watch, very stylish with editing and such, to the point that its so over the top feeling, at least earlier in the film, that it felt close to parody for me.  I don't know, it's like you watch a few of the parody biopics like Weird Al or Walk Hard: The Dewey Cox Story, and they hit on the cliche's of biopics, so you notice them more, but this one does a lot to stand out, it's trying to be really out there while having some very heartfelt moments.  Butler was great as Elvis too, I thought he nailed it.  Hanks I think did fine, though it's hard to just not see Hanks in a fat suit lol Though looking it up, it's weird they gave Parker such a noticeable accent.  I looked up an interview from the 80's and he didn't even have one really and there's audio from from the 50's with a little bit of the accent, but not as much as I felt Hanks gave it.  Abit much.

Overall an interesting and entertaining watch.

10 - Sons of the Forest (PC 2024) - BEAT - With the game out of EA, I dove back to see what was added and improved since I originally played it.  It was pretty barebones back then, mostly just the fundamental gameplay, location, and visuals worked out and then some other general features.  I think they overall did a good job, but there's a lot of cut corners here.  The survival aspect of the game is very basic, it really needed a lot more depth, along with needing to drastically overhaul the amount of animals and supplies you can find.  There's a custom game mode difficulty that allows you to change a ton of stuff, but the normal mode should've been way better.  I just don't think it got enough playtesting as I would've made normal have weaker enemies, but harsher supply and animal cut.

The story is there, it's sorta similar to the first one where you get bits here and there, you piece together stuff from the past through notes and such, to figure out what happened, and I think it mostly works, but it's not a strong narrative.  The first game did it a little better as there was more of a drive to it being a father looking for his son, rather than who your character is who just isn't really important to the story.  He's not a no name guy, but it kinda feels that way.

There's other things I could call out here and there, as I think the game needed another few months of cleaning up and a few more additions, but overall I liked it.  There are better survival games out there, but I had enough fun with this one, I just hope they are going to continue adding to the game, give me a reason to go back as there more than a few areas on the map they could add stuff to.
